For those of you whose babies/toddlers are already walking....how long did it take your baby from when they did their step/s to when they were full on walking?For the past couple of weeks Ella has been doing random steps unassisted and today she did 7 steps in a row. Just wondering how long I have until my baby is no longer a baby....... just curious really

Jack was about a month. I think it depends how confident they are, if they take a step as soon as they can stand it will take it bit longer than a baby who stands for a while and then steps.
